Ingredients
Zucchini Grilled Cheese made with crispy garlic butter zucchini patties and melted cheddar cheese is a low-carb twist on the classic sandwich.
For the Patties
- 2 cups grated zucchini
- 1 large egg
- ½ cup freshly grated Parmesan
- ¼ cup cornstarch
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- 2 T Fresh Churned Garlic Butter
For the Sandwich
- 1–2 cups shredded Cheddar
How to Make Zucchini Grilled Cheese
Step 1: Squeeze Moisture from Zucchini
Squeeze moisture out of grated zucchini using a cheesecloth or kitchen towel. This step is crucial for ensuring your patties don’t become soggy.
Step 2: Prepare the Mixture
Place dry zucchini in a mixing bowl and add egg, Parmesan, cornstarch, salt, and pepper. Mix well with a fork until combined into a dough-like texture.
Step 3: Heat the Skillet
Heat garlic butter in a skillet over medium heat. This will give your patties that delicious garlic flavor as they cook.
Step 4: Form Patties and Cook
Scoop half the zucchini mixture into the skillet and shape it into a patty; repeat for the second patty. Cook each patty for 3–4 minutes per side until golden brown and crisp.
Step 5: Assemble Your Sandwich
Add shredded cheddar cheese on one patty, place the second on top to form a sandwich. Cook for an additional 3 minutes until cheese is melted.
Step 6: Serve and Enjoy
Remove from skillet, let cool slightly, slice, and serve your Zucchini Grilled Cheese warm for maximum enjoyment!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When making Zucchini Grilled Cheese, a few mistakes can affect the taste and texture of your dish. Here are some common pitfalls to watch out for:
-
Overlooking moisture removal: Failing to squeeze out excess moisture from the zucchini can lead to soggy patties. Always use a cheesecloth or kitchen towel to ensure your zucchini is dry.
-
Insufficient mixing: Not mixing the ingredients well enough can result in poorly formed patties. Make sure to combine the zucchini with egg, Parmesan, and cornstarch until you achieve a dough-like consistency.
-
Cooking at too high a temperature: Cooking on high heat can burn the outside of the patties while leaving them raw inside. Stick to medium heat for even cooking and a golden-brown finish.
-
Ignoring portion sizes: Making patties that are too thick can prevent them from cooking properly. Aim for even thickness to ensure your Zucchini Grilled Cheese cooks through evenly.
-
Rushing the cheese melting process: Trying to rush melting the cheese by increasing heat may lead to burnt patties. Allow it time on low heat for perfect gooeyness.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store any leftovers in an airtight container.
- They will remain fresh for up to 3 days in the refrigerator.
Freezing Zucchini Grilled Cheese
- Place cooled patties in a freezer-safe container or wrap them individually.
- They can be frozen for up to 2 months for best quality.
Reheating Zucchini Grilled Cheese
- Oven: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Place patties on a baking sheet and warm for about 10-15 minutes until heated through.
- Microwave: Use a microwave-safe plate and cover with a damp paper towel. Heat in short intervals (30 seconds) until warm.
- Stovetop: Heat a skillet over medium heat, add a little garlic butter, and reheat patties for about 2-3 minutes per side.

What can I use instead of Parmesan?
You can substitute with nutritional yeast for a vegan option or any hard cheese like Pecorino Romano if you’re looking for something different.
Can I make Zucchini Grilled Cheese ahead of time?
Absolutely! Prepare the mixture and form patties before storing them in the fridge or freezer until you’re ready to cook.
